SK Hynix (NASDAQ: SKHY) stock enjoyed a strong rally this week, with its share price rising 20.6% across the stretch. The S&P 500 rose 1.2% over the period, and the Nasdaq Composite gained 1.7%.

SK Hynix's share price moved higher due to news that Singapore's sovereign wealth fund was poised to invest in the company and a new market share report from Counterpoint Research. Bullish momentum for the broader South Korean stock market also helped to lift the stock.

Singapore plans to invest in SK Hynix

News hit on Wednesday that Singapore's Temasek wealth fund will be investing in SK Hynix and Samsung. Both companies are leading players in the memory chip market, and the vote of confidence from Singapore's sovereign fund helped power substantial rallies for each stock.

Valuations for South Korean chip stocks and the country's stock market at large have been volatile recently, but momentum turned bullish this week. Samsung and SK Hynix are South Korea's two largest companies by market capitalization and have a huge impact on valuation directionality for the broader market, and both stocks can also see pricing moves compounded by the sentiment shifts they help to shape.

A recent report bodes well for SK Hynix

Counterpoint Research published its latest market share report on the NAND memory market this week, and investors saw it as a positive indicator for SK Hynix. While the company's market share of 22% in Q2 still put it behind Samsung's market share of 25%, the firm said that SK Hynix was benefiting from its rival's supply constraints. Counterpoint also highlighted strong growth for the company's Solidigm subsidiary.

SK Hynix stock has been highly volatile over the last month and could continue to see big swings, but the demand outlook in the memory chip market continues to look very strong.
